Fridayy’s Debut Self-Titled Album Is Here Featuring Chris Brown, Fireboy DML, And More

Music lovers were disappointed when Drake failed to deliver For All The Dogs to us at midnight on Friday (August 25). Even with that letdown, the industry still turned out plenty of exciting new releases, including a debut LP from rising R&B sensation Fridayy. The singer shared 14 songs with us on his self-titled effort, including the previously released “Don’t Give It Away” with Chris Brown and “When It Comes To You.”

Besides the Breezy collaboration, Fridayy also linked up with a selection of other artists throughout his tracklist. He opens with “Came Too Far” featuring Maverick City Music and My Mom. That joint effort is immediately followed by Adekunle Gold’s appearance on “Done For Me.” The Philadelphia-born creative held his own on several other titles before teaming up with Fireboy DML on “You,” and Byron Messia on “Mercy.”

Fridayy’s Debut Album Accompanied By “Stand By Me” Visual

Along with the album’s arrival on DSPs, the “GOD DID” collaborator also shared a new visual for “Stand By Me,” the project’s third song. It finds him singing alongside striking employees and perfectly captures the energy fluctuating around the entertainment industry at this time. “If I say I’m standing for you / You know that I’m ‘a standing ten toes,” the 26-year-old sings of his own loyalty.

Cardi B Shares Newest Update On Her New Album

Cardi B’s massively successful debut album Invasion Of Privacy was released 5 years ago in 2018 and has yet to receive a follow-up. While she’s teased fans occasionally about releasing a follow-up, it’s been a while since she really touched on the idea of a forthcoming project. That streak was broken by a new interview in Vogue Mexico. In the interview, she gives details on when fans can expect both a new single from her, and eventually a new album.

“I’m not going to release any more collaborations, I’m going to put out my next solo single. Right now I’m working on the cover art and ideas for the next record because it’s definitely coming up,” Cardi B explained. She further elaborated on when the plans will be set in motion and clarified that once her new era starts it will unfold in rapid-fire fashion. So stay tuned because it’s coming out very soon,’ she assures. I also have plans in the world of cinema. In fact, I have plans to do everything I can: fashion, branding, I want to do it all, honey.”

Vic Mensa Previews “Victor” With New Single, “Blue Eyes”

Vic Mensa is an artist who has gone through various evolutions throughout his career. Overall, he is an artist who has a dedicated fanbase and is always interested in his next move. Coming out of Chicago, Vic has received a ton of co-signs, particularly from the likes of Kanye West and Chance The Rapper. Just a few years ago, Mensa decided to change things up and entered the world of punk rock. However, since that time, he has found his way back to his first love, hip-hop.

On September 15th, the artist will be dropping a brand-new album titled Victor. This is going to be a huge project for Mensa, and he is looking to make the most of it. To promote the project, he has come through with a brand-new single, simply titled “Blue Eyes.” The song is an emotional one for Mensa, as he speaks on his experience with wishing he were white due to the racism he faced. He also speaks of a woman who attempted to appear lighter-skinned but eventually got cancer in the process.

Victoria Monet & Lucky Daye Make Magic On Her Debut “JAGUAR II” Album: Stream

As many of our favourite male MCs have made note of lately, the women of hip-hop and R&B have been holding it down in 2023. Things have definitely heated up for the men in the latter half of the year, but the fairer sex has consistently been dropping hits and conquering the charts in both genres. This weekend, it’s Victoria Monet’s debut JAGUAR II album that’s taking the spotlight, with features from Lucky Daye and Buju Banton previously arriving as singles.

The former opens the 11-track project with “Smoke,” while the latter appears on “Party Girls.” Besides those two titles, “On My Mama” has also been all over social media this summer, especially now that Monet has graced us with an accompanying visual. Elsewhere on JAGUAR II, the songbird connected with Earth, Wild & Fire as well as her 2-year-old daughter, Hazel, on “Hollywood” before closing the LP out with “Good Bye.”

Read More: Victoria Monet Announces “JAGUAR II” Album & Tour Dates

Victoria Monet’s Debut Album Will Take You to “Hollywood”

During an interview with Teen Vogue, the mother of one spoke candidly about her creative process as an artist. “I definitely, internally, always am in competition with no one but myself,” Monet explained. “I guess it’s healthy to want to be better and progress, but I try to keep it out of my mind when I’m actually in the studio because your brain gets busy, so I try to stay in that moment. But now that the project’s done, I can sit back and be like, ‘Yes, I think it’s better than Jaguar.’”
